TV Deal of the Week
Brunson burner? Philly TV goes into a Crouch
Philadelphia's Channel 48 offering, WGTW-TV, is going to a California-based Religious non-com operation headed by Paul Crouch. In fact, Crouch's Trinity Christian Center of Santa Ana is paying $1M per channel number - $48M - - to get the station, easily making it the TV Deal of the Week. Seller is Brunson Communications Inc.
Radio Deal of the Week
Mercatanti on the hunt in Vermont
A pair of Vermont FMs are going to Louis Mercatanti's Nassau Broadcasting, part of the group's ongoing expansion in the outer reaches of New England. The stations, WEXP-FM Brandon VT and WVAY-FM Wilmington VT, are coming from Vox. Despite being beyond the boundaries of Arbitron, the deal is good enough, during a slow week, for Radio Deal of the Week honors.
